Banana Peel (French: Peau de banane, Italian: Buccia di banana, German: Heißes Pflaster) is a 1963 French-Italian-German comedy film starring Jeanne Moreau and Jean Paul Belmondo. Costumes by Pierre Cardin.

It recorded admissions in France of 1,909,913.[1]
